如何快速创建完美岛屿布局:HappyIslandDesigner终极指南
HappyIslandDesigner是一个基于浏览器的免费在线工具,专为《动物森友会》玩家和岛屿设计爱好者打造。这个强大的工具让你能够在游戏外预先规划岛屿布局,设计河流、悬崖、建筑位置,实现完美的岛屿规划而无需在游戏中反复调整。支持自动保存、撤销/重做、缩放、高质量渲染等功能,让你的岛屿设计过程更加高效直观。
项目核心亮点
为什么要使用HappyIslandDesigner?以下是它解决玩家痛点的关键功能:
-
可视化岛屿规划:告别在游戏中盲目尝试的烦恼。通过清晰的网格系统和地形预览,你可以精确规划每一块土地的使用,避免资源浪费和时间消耗。
-
离线设计与保存:不需要启动游戏即可进行设计,所有进度自动保存到浏览器本地存储。你可以随时中断设计,稍后继续,不会丢失任何进度。
-
完整的地形编辑工具:提供河流、悬崖、沙滩等地形编辑功能,支持直线和斜线绘制,按住Shift键可绘制直线,让地形设计更加精准。
-
丰富的建筑和装饰库:包含机场、房屋、博物馆、商店、桥梁、斜坡、各种树木和花卉等完整元素库,所有图标都提供扁平和高清两种显示模式。
-
智能图像保存技术:采用隐写术技术将地图数据编码到图像文件的Alpha通道中,保存的图片既包含视觉预览也包含完整的设计数据,支持从图片重新加载设计。
-
多语言界面支持:支持英语、简体中文、繁体中文、西班牙语、日语、韩语、法语、德语等多种语言,全球玩家都能轻松使用。
-
响应式设计:支持桌面和移动设备,在手机上支持双指缩放和平移操作,让你随时随地设计岛屿。
快速上手指南
第一步:访问在线工具
直接在浏览器中打开HappyIslandDesigner的在线版本,无需下载安装。工具完全在浏览器中运行,支持Chrome、Firefox、Safari等现代浏览器。
第二步:选择岛屿模板
工具提供多种预设岛屿布局,包括东向、南向、西向等不同河流出口位置的选择。点击"新建"按钮,从预设模板中选择适合的起点。
第三步:使用地形编辑工具
在左侧工具栏中选择地形工具,开始绘制河流、悬崖和沙滩。使用不同颜色代表不同地形类型,按住Shift键可绘制直线,按住Alt键并滚动可缩放视图。
第四步:放置建筑和设施
点击左侧的建筑工具图标,从丰富的建筑库中选择房屋、博物馆、商店等设施。每个建筑都有精确的网格尺寸,确保在游戏中的正确放置。
第五步:添加植被和装饰
使用树木和花卉工具为岛屿添加绿化。工具提供多种树木类型(果树、松树、竹子)和花卉品种(玫瑰、郁金香、菊花等),让你的岛屿更加生动。
第六步:保存和分享设计
完成设计后,点击保存按钮将岛屿设计导出为PNG图片。图片中包含了完整的岛屿数据,你可以随时重新加载继续编辑,或分享给其他玩家。
第七步:导入游戏参考
将保存的设计图片作为参考,在《动物森友会》游戏中按照规划进行建设。工具使用与游戏相同的网格系统,确保设计能够准确实施。
进阶使用技巧
1. 高级地形编辑技巧
HappyIslandDesigner支持复杂的地形编辑操作。在app/drawer.ts中,你可以找到地形绘制算法的实现。工具使用Paper.js库进行矢量路径渲染,当你绘制时,系统会计算从上一个鼠标位置到当前位置的刷子形状形成的矢量形状。由于地图只允许直线或对角线,系统会将线条分解为直线或对角线。
技巧:按住Alt键并点击颜色可以快速切换到该颜色,这在频繁切换地形类型时非常高效。
2. 自定义对象管理
工具的对象系统支持异步加载和渲染。在app/helpers/getObjectData.ts中,你可以了解对象数据的处理逻辑。每个对象都使用最小化的数据结构表示,在编码地图数据时只存储必要信息,解码时再根据这些信息渲染相应的对象。
技巧:使用对象面板可以快速筛选和查找特定类型的建筑或装饰,支持按名称搜索。
3. 本地开发与自定义
如果你想扩展工具功能或进行二次开发,项目提供了完整的本地开发环境。首先克隆仓库:
git clone https://gitcode.com/gh_mirrors/ha/HappyIslandDesigner.git
cd HappyIslandDesigner
yarn
yarn dev
开发服务器将在http://localhost:8080/启动,支持热重载。项目使用TypeScript编写,主要绘图逻辑基于Paper.js,UI部分使用React。
自定义扩展:你可以在app/tools/目录中添加新的工具类型,或在app/components/中修改UI组件。
4. 快捷键高效操作
掌握快捷键可以大幅提升设计效率:
Shift:绘制直线Alt+ 点击颜色:切换到该颜色Alt+ 滚动:缩放视图空格键+ 拖动:平移视图- 双击工具图标:隐藏/显示工具弹出菜单
总结与资源
HappyIslandDesigner为《动物森友会》玩家提供了一个专业级的岛屿规划工具,解决了游戏中反复调整布局的痛点。通过可视化设计、精确网格系统和丰富的元素库,你可以轻松创建梦想中的岛屿布局。
核心优势:
- 完全免费,基于浏览器运行
- 支持离线使用和自动保存
- 与游戏网格系统完全兼容
- 设计数据嵌入图片,便于分享和备份
技术文档:
注意事项:
- 保存的图片不要编辑或压缩,否则嵌入的数据可能会损坏
- 移动端横屏模式可能导致UI被截断
- 如果浏览器崩溃,可以在控制台中运行
editor.clearAutosave()清除自动保存文件
无论你是想要精确规划岛屿的专业玩家,还是希望尝试不同布局方案的创意设计师,HappyIslandDesigner都能为你提供强大的支持。开始设计你的完美岛屿,让《动物森友会》的游戏体验更加丰富和有趣!
atomcodeClaude Code 的开源替代方案。连接任意大模型,编辑代码,运行命令,自动验证 — 全自动执行。用 Rust 构建,极致性能。 | An open-source alternative to Claude Code. Connect any LLM, edit code, run commands, and verify changes — autonomously. Built in Rust for speed. Get StartedRust0152- DDeepSeek-V4-ProDeepSeek-V4-Pro(总参数 1.6 万亿,激活 49B)面向复杂推理和高级编程任务,在代码竞赛、数学推理、Agent 工作流等场景表现优异,性能接近国际前沿闭源模型。Python00
LongCat-Video-Avatar-1.5最新开源LongCat-Video-Avatar 1.5 版本,这是一款经过升级的开源框架,专注于音频驱动人物视频生成的极致实证优化与生产级就绪能力。该版本在 LongCat-Video 基础模型之上构建,可生成高度稳定的商用级虚拟人视频,支持音频-文本转视频(AT2V)、音频-文本-图像转视频(ATI2V)以及视频续播等原生任务,并能无缝兼容单流与多流音频输入。00
auto-devAutoDev 是一个 AI 驱动的辅助编程插件。AutoDev 支持一键生成测试、代码、提交信息等,还能够与您的需求管理系统(例如Jira、Trello、Github Issue 等)直接对接。 在IDE 中,您只需简单点击,AutoDev 会根据您的需求自动为您生成代码。Kotlin03
Intern-S2-PreviewIntern-S2-Preview,这是一款高效的350亿参数科学多模态基础模型。除了常规的参数与数据规模扩展外,Intern-S2-Preview探索了任务扩展:通过提升科学任务的难度、多样性与覆盖范围,进一步释放模型能力。Python00
skillhubopenJiuwen 生态的 Skill 托管与分发开源方案,支持自建与可选 ClawHub 兼容。Python0112






